
National Origin
National origin refers to a person's country of birth or their family’s country of origin. It includes their cultural background, language, and heritage associated with that country. This means that if someone was born in or has ancestral roots from a specific nation, that is their national origin. Laws protecting against discrimination based on national origin aim to ensure individuals are treated fairly and not unfairly judged because of where they or their ancestors come from, regardless of their current nationality or citizenship.
